Profile
Personal
- Resided in Oakland, California in 1953.
- Self-identified as being of French ancestry.
- Shows his hobbies are hunting and fishing.
Pre-professional career
- Graduated from Anderson Union High School.
- Played baseball in high school.
- Pitched two no-hit games in high school against the same club, Red Bluff.
Outside of baseball
- Is a salesman during the off-season.
- Served in the U. S. Army for two years.
Playing in less than ten games statistics
- 1950 Porterville Sunset League 8 G, 42 IP, 3 W, 3 L, .500 PCT., 5.57 ERA
